About [EN]GAGE
[EN]GAGE is home to our state-of-the-art sport and fitness facility, based at our Sighthill campus. Open to students, staff, members, and the public, it offers an inclusive, fun, and welcoming environment for everyone. The centre features a fully equipped fitness suite with resistance and cardio machines, treadmills, free weights, and a performance area for strength and conditioning.
